Bubbleでのトーナメント作成について

Bubbleでスポーツの大会(トーナメントなど)を作成、管理する機能を実装したいと考えています。
スポーツの試合はシングルエリミネーション、ダブルエリミネーション、総当たり戦など、いろいろなやり方があり、それらを全てを一から実装し、適切な形で表示するのはかなり大変かと思っております。
Bubble上で組み込めるプラグインがありそうな気もしたのですが、見つけられておりません。
もし、プラグインやBubbleと連携しやすい外部サービスなど、効率的な実装方法をご存じの方がいれば情報頂けないでしょうか。

1.前提条件

・Bubbleを使ってスポーツ大会の管理・運営が出来るアプリを開発したい
・大会(試合)の形式に合わせた形でトーナメントを作成し、各チームの勝ち負けなどを登録したい
・勝敗やスコアはBubble上のデータベースにて管理したい(外部サービスを利用する場合も、勝敗や何回戦で勝った・負けたを管理する機能は必要)
・大会(トーナメント)の作成はアプリに登録しているユーザーが作成できる(アプリの運営者が作成するわけでは無い)。そのため、外部サービスを使った場合もBubbleのユーザーが得点や勝ち負けを登録できる必要がある

2.補足情報 (調べたURL/参考になりそうな事例)

  • Common Ninjaの"Brackets & Tournaments"というサービスが検索では出てきますが、トーナメントの運営を自分自身で行わない場合は使えなさそう
  • Challongeというサービスを利用されようとした方の情報はありましたが、実装出来たかなどは不明でした
  • OrgChartという組織図を作成するpluginでトーナメント風の表示は出来そうですが、ベースが組織図の表示なので、表示内容の自由度はかなり限られてしまいます

※※※※※※※※※※※※※※※※※※
この返信はAIによる自動応答です。
トピック作成時のみに投稿されます。
※※※※※※※※※※※※※※※※※※

スポーツ大会の管理をBubbleで実現するためには、いくつかの方法があります。以下にいくつかの選択肢を紹介します。

  1. Challonge APIの利用:

    • Challongeはトーナメント管理に特化したサービスで、APIを通じてBubbleと連携させることができます。APIを使ってトーナメントの作成、管理、結果の更新が可能です。BubbleのAPIコネクターを利用して、ChallongeのAPIと通信する方法があります。
  2. プラグインの利用:

    • 現在のところ、Bubbleのプラグインマーケットプレイスには直接トーナメント管理を行うプラグインは見当たりませんが、他のプラグインを組み合わせて独自に実装することが可能です。
    • 例えば、視覚的にトーナメントを表示するために「OrgChart」などのプラグインをカスタマイズすることも考えられます。
  3. 外部サービスとの連携:

    • Common Ninjaや他のトーナメント管理サービスを利用することも一つの方法です。これらのサービスが提供する埋め込み機能を使って、Bubbleアプリケーション内でトーナメントを表示することができます。
  4. カスタム開発:

    • すべての要件を満たすために、Bubble内でカスタムのデータベース構造を作成し、ワークフローを組むことで独自のトーナメント管理システムを構築することも可能です。この場合、ユーザーがトーナメントを作成し、結果を更新できるようなUIを設計する必要があります。

これらの方法を組み合わせることで、Bubble上で効率的にスポーツ大会を管理するシステムを構築できます。特にChallongeのような既存のサービスのAPIを利用することで、実装の手間を大幅に減らすことができるでしょう。

Challonge APIについては以下のURLを参考にしてください。